Transaction 3712881953129de156320dd81660c6f62417f179d5ec99a6276337a308571fbe
1 Input
1 Output
-
3712881953129de156320dd81660c6f62417f179d5ec99a6276337a308571fbe:0
- value
- 411983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29db4acc35b01a2d2d21ab7516d6889792933df1 OP_EQUAL
- address
- 35WLL6Yp2DwSboH4oMuv6oSwc3zrVbnP6k